
Kanayo O. Kanayo, a veteran Nollywood actor, has expressed his frustration with Instagram, accusing the platform of unfair treatment. In a video message, he lamented that his followers have been dropping for months, despite his active presence on the platform.
Kanayo argued that it’s impossible for him not to have gained new fans in the last few months, suggesting that Instagram’s algorithm may be to blame. He emphasized that this issue isn’t unique to him, implying that other users may be experiencing similar problems.
The actor’s concerns highlight the ongoing challenges faced by content creators on social media platforms, where algorithms can significantly impact their online presence and engagement.
He said,
“I have noticed that for the past seven to eight months, my Instagram page followership which was about 2.2 or 2.3 million was brought down to 1.9 million.
“It is that my followership has not added up to one thousand for seven to eight months? It’s a matter of concern because it’s happening to a lot of people. We are using a platform that we have no control over and the way that they are treating us is very bad. So I’m calling on the owners of Instagram to treat us like content creators; it’s beneficial to you as well as it’s complementary beneficial to us.”
